全部版块 我的主页
论坛 提问 悬赏 求职 新闻 读书 功能一区 悬赏大厅 求助成功区
2062 11
2012-06-10
悬赏 5 个论坛币 已解决
我是把xls文件用xlsread命令导入matlab中的,但是本身xls中数据是有缺失的,导入matlab中变为NaN,现在需要把matlab中的NaN全部变为0,xls中的缺失数据繁琐无规律不易全部填0.所以请问大家,matlab中有没有相应的函数能达到我的要求 或是如何让Excel文件在缺省区域上全部补上0呢?

最佳答案

mj2012 查看完整内容

假设a是含nan的矩阵,可用 a(isnan(a))=0这样的语句对矩阵赋值,效率比较高。
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

全部回复
2012-6-10 21:56:00
假设a是含nan的矩阵,可用 a(isnan(a))=0这样的语句对矩阵赋值,效率比较高。
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

2012-6-10 22:00:45
据我所知没有。
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

2012-6-10 22:02:05
excel里条件选择,然后修改就可以了
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

2012-6-10 22:02:33
貌似导入spss可以把缺失值全部改为0
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

2012-6-10 22:19:42
AZURESKY 发表于 2012-6-10 22:02
excel里条件选择,然后修改就可以了
不知道怎么改啊
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

点击查看更多内容…

分享

扫码加好友,拉您进群